Popular content creator Apoorva Mukhija, better known as Rebel Kid, has just dropped a candid and humorous video on her YouTube channel, offering fans a behind-the-scenes look into her recent glow-up journey that cost her around Rs 3 lakh. In the 11-minute vlog, Apoorva shared that that she got everything from a hair makeover and teeth veneers to nails, brows, and even a facial massage, all documented with her signature self-deprecating humour and quirky commentary. For those unfamiliar, Apoorva Mukhija made headlines earlier this year when she appeared on comedian Samay Raina’s controversial panel show India’s Got Latent, alongside creators like Ranveer Allahbadia and Ashish Chanchlani. The episode sparked massive backlash online due to its use of objectionable language, leading to FIRs against the panel members. The situation escalated so much that Apoorva was reportedly asked to vacate her rented home.
Most recently, Apoorva appeared in Amazon Prime Video’s reality show The Traitors and was also featured in filmmaker Farah Khan’s YouTube series, where Farah visits celebrity homes with her personal chef, Dilip.
